Overview
Great Horizon Ranch, identified as 2XA1, is a private airstrip near Cotulla, Texas, serving the surrounding ranch country south of San Antonio. The field offers a single paved runway and operates without staffing, so pilots should expect no on-field services or personnel. Customs clearance is not available on site; the nearest option is Laredo International, roughly 45 nautical miles away. Traffic at this facility is light, consistent with its role supporting private ranch operations rather than commercial or high-frequency business aviation activity.
Great Horizon Ranch Airport has one paved runway, 13/31, 5,500 ft long and 75 ft wide, with an asphalt surface.

Great Horizon Ranch Airport has published operating constraints in one category: other notes.
All traffic should remain west of the airport.
Numerous military aircraft are in the vicinity of the traffic pattern.
For clearance delivery, contact Houston Air Route Traffic Control Center.

Great Horizon Ranch, local identifier 2XA1, is a private airport near Cotulla, Texas, at an elevation of 317 feet. It sits roughly 60 nautical miles from the nearest metro area. The field is unattended, with no scheduled staffing at any time. Pilots operating here should plan on self-sufficient operations without on-field personnel support.
Yes, Great Horizon Ranch has one paved runway, designated 13/31, measuring 5,500 feet long and 75 feet wide with an asphalt surface. This is the only runway listed for the field. The dimensions support a range of business aviation aircraft, though the airport remains unattended and privately operated.
Great Horizon Ranch does not have customs service on site. The nearest customs-equipped airport is Laredo International, KLRD, located approximately 45.38 nautical miles away. Operators requiring customs clearance near this Texas ranch strip must plan a stop at KLRD or another designated facility before or after their visit.
